What Are the Key Advantages of Switching to a Lithium Battery for Golf Carts?
The key advantages of switching to a lithium battery for golf carts include improved performance, longer lifespan, and reduced weight.
- Improved Performance: Lithium batteries provide consistent power output, ensuring that golf carts maintain high speeds and efficiency throughout their charge cycle. This leads to better acceleration and responsiveness, enhancing the overall driving experience on the course.
- Longer Lifespan: Compared to traditional lead-acid batteries, lithium batteries can last significantly longer, often exceeding 2000 charge cycles. This longevity means less frequent replacements and lower long-term costs for golf cart owners.
- Reduced Weight: Lithium batteries are much lighter than their lead-acid counterparts, which can improve the cart’s overall performance and handling. The reduced weight also allows for increased payload capacity, making it easier to transport additional gear or passengers.
- Faster Charging: Lithium batteries can be charged more quickly, often reaching full capacity in just a few hours. This convenience is particularly beneficial for golf courses where carts are in constant use, minimizing downtime between rounds.
- Environmentally Friendly: Lithium batteries contain fewer toxic materials than lead-acid batteries and are more recyclable, making them a more sustainable choice for eco-conscious consumers. This aspect aligns with the growing trend towards greener practices in the golfing industry.
- Maintenance-Free: Unlike lead-acid batteries, which require regular maintenance such as checking water levels and cleaning terminals, lithium batteries are largely maintenance-free. This ease of use saves time and effort for golf cart owners.

What Is the Step-by-Step Installation Process for a 48V Lithium Battery Conversion Kit?
A 48V lithium battery conversion kit is designed to replace traditional lead-acid batteries in golf carts with lithium-ion batteries, enhancing performance, efficiency, and longevity. These conversion kits typically include a lithium battery pack, a battery management system (BMS), and necessary connectors and hardware for installation.
According to the U.S. Department of Energy, lithium-ion batteries offer higher energy density and longer cycle life compared to lead-acid batteries, making them a more efficient choice for applications such as golf carts (source: U.S. DOE). The best 48V golf cart lithium battery conversion kits allow for a significant weight reduction, which improves the cart’s speed and handling while also extending the driving range on a single charge.
The installation process for a 48V lithium battery conversion kit generally involves several key steps: first, the golf cart must be prepared by disconnecting and removing the old lead-acid batteries. Next, the new lithium battery pack is securely installed in the designated battery compartment, ensuring that it is properly supported and that connections are made to the existing wiring harness. The BMS should be connected to monitor the battery’s health and performance. Finally, the system is tested to ensure that everything functions correctly before putting the golf cart back into service.
This conversion process can have significant impacts on performance and operational costs. Lithium batteries typically have a lifespan of 2,000 to 5,000 cycles, compared to around 300-500 cycles for lead-acid batteries. This longevity translates to fewer replacements and lower long-term costs for golf cart owners. Additionally, lithium batteries charge faster and maintain charge better, providing a more reliable source of power.
Benefits of utilizing a lithium battery conversion kit include reduced maintenance requirements, as lithium batteries do not require regular watering or equalization. Furthermore, these batteries operate efficiently in a wider range of temperatures, which can be particularly beneficial in varying climatic conditions. As golf carts equipped with lithium batteries can achieve higher speeds and longer distances, they are better suited for both recreational use and commercial applications.
Best practices for ensuring a successful installation include carefully following the manufacturer’s guidelines, checking for compatibility with the golf cart model, and ensuring that all electrical connections are secure and insulated. Additionally, it is advisable to consider professional installation if one is not comfortable with electrical systems, as improper installation can lead to safety hazards or damage to the cart.
What Maintenance Practices Are Essential for a 48V Lithium Battery After Installation?
Essential maintenance practices for a 48V lithium battery after installation include:
- Regular Charging: Consistent charging is crucial to maintaining battery health. Lithium batteries perform best when they are kept between 20% and 80% charge levels, preventing deep discharges and overcharging which can shorten their lifespan.
- Temperature Monitoring: It is important to keep the battery within optimal temperature ranges. Extreme temperatures can negatively affect performance, so storing the battery in a controlled environment helps prevent damage and ensures efficient operation.
- Visual Inspections: Conducting regular visual checks for any signs of wear, damage, or corrosion is vital. This proactive approach enables early detection of potential issues, such as loose connections or physical damage that could impact battery performance.
- Connection Maintenance: Ensuring that all connections are clean and secure is essential for optimal performance. Loose or corroded connections can lead to power loss or overheating, so regular tightening and cleaning of terminals should be part of your maintenance routine.
- Balancing Cells: Regularly checking and balancing the individual cells in the battery pack can help maintain uniform charge levels. This ensures that no single cell is overworked or undercharged, maximizing the efficiency and lifespan of the battery.
- Firmware Updates: Staying updated with the latest firmware for the battery management system is important. Manufacturers may release updates that improve performance, safety features, or overall battery management, ensuring your battery operates at its best.
